Hi,

Does anyone knows why the keyword field have been removed from the bookmark properties accessible with the blue star in the omnibar ?

I do find a lot of posts about the description field removal, but nothing about the keyword field.

Keywords are still working in firefox 65 but managing or assigning them became a real pain in the @%µ£.

Thanks for your infos.

Gekozen oplossing

When you are using either the Bookmarks Menu (Alt+b), Bookmarks Toolbar, or Bookmarks Sidebar (Ctrl+b), you can right-click the bookmark you want to edit and click Properties on the context menu.

Hi Pj, keyword is a shortcut for the address bar. For example, you can associate gm with Gmail and ms with Mozilla Support, and then to load those bookmarks, type the keyword in the address bar and press Enter. Search boxes also can be saved as keyworded bookmarks.
